How Much Does a House Extension Cost? Average Prices by Type
The cost of a house extension varies significantly based on size, design, and location. On average, a single-storey extension costs between £20,000 and £50,000, while a two-storey extension ranges from £40,000 to £100,000. Factors like materials, labour, and site conditions can push these figures higher. For instance, a standard 3m x 4m extension might cost around £25,000, but luxury finishes or complex architectural designs can double the price. Always get multiple quotes and factor in planning permission and building regulations.
Key Factors Influencing the Cost of Your Extension
Several elements impact the final price of your extension. Firstly, location matters: urban areas often have higher labour and material costs. Secondly, the type of extension (single vs. double storey) affects the budget. Thirdly, the choice of materials (e.g., brick vs. timber frame) can significantly alter costs. Additionally, site preparation, including foundations and drainage, may add £5,000 to £15,000. Don't forget to account for professional fees such as architects and surveyors, which can be 10-15% of the total project cost. Understanding these variables helps in accurate budgeting.
Saving Money on Your Extension: Practical Tips
To avoid budget overruns, start with a realistic budget based on detailed planning. Consider simple designs without complex features. Opt for standard materials that offer good value. If possible, do some tasks yourself (like painting) to save on labour. Remember that planning permission costs vary, but sometimes a permitted development right can save you £1,000-£2,000. Also, choose a reputable contractor who provides clear contracts to prevent hidden charges. Planning carefully can save thousands without compromising quality.
